What Is This Session About?

Learning agility is the cornerstone of personal and professional success, empowering individuals to rapidly acquire new skills, excel in their roles, and remain employable in ever-evolving environments. It fosters a willingness to learn new competencies to perform under tough or unfamiliar conditions, and the ability to learn from past experiences. Agile learners turn every challenge into an opportunity for growth. This course focuses on equipping individuals with the skills needed to excel in an environment characterised by volatility, uncertainty, complexity, and ambiguity (VUCA). You will acquire the mindset, skillset and toolset to develop the various facets of learning agility: CHANGE agility, RESULT agility, MENTAL agility, PEOPLE agility, and SELF-AWARENESS. Participants will engage with experiential learning and practical application through interactive activities, debriefing sessions, and structured content delivery, emerging from this course with a growth mindset for success.

Additional Funding Available, If Applicable

Singaporeans aged 25 years old and above are eligible for SkillsFuture Credit which can be used to offset the selected programmes' fees for self-sponsored registrations only.


Please note the submission period for your SFC claim via MySkillsFuture needs to be within 60 days before the course start date (date inclusive). If your course start date is more than 60 days from the date of SFC application, the SSG-SFC portal would reject your application. In this case, you would need to pay the full course fees at the end of your course application.
